This PR exports the
HUB_URL
constant from the hub package so that consumers can directly access it in their applications.Changes
export { HUB_URL } from "./consts";
topackages/hub/src/index.ts
Usage Example
This is useful for applications that need to reference the default hub URL or construct hub-related URLs in their code, without having to define the constant themselves.
